JACKSON TOWNSHIP & MORGANTOWN
PAGE 257
GEORGE M. MONTGOMERY, hardware merchant at Morgantown, is a native of
Johnson County, Ind., and is the second child of his parents, Duncan and
Lillis (Holman) Montgomery, the former a native of Scotland, the latter of
Indiana. Mr. Montgomery emigrated to America in 1832. George M. was born
December 15, 1853; he was reared a farmer,and worked thereat and attended
school until he was sixteen years old, at which time he became a cripple,
and thus incapacitated from farm labor, although he is owner of 137 1/2
acres of excellent land, improved and cultivated. In the summer of 1880, he
moved to Morgantown and purchased the hardware business of James S. Comer,
which he has since managed successfully and satisfactorily. He carries a
varied stock of about $3,500, which is increasing. October 17, 1876, he
married Miss Mary E. Bass, and to them have been born two children--Arthur
D. and Ivey M. Mr. Montgomery is a Liberal in politics, an upright and
watchful merchant, and a generally esteemed citizen.
